Nevermore_ said:
As a former or "recovering" Catholic, I actually know a site where you can look stuff like this up (: Off the tuktok of my head I was going to say Saint Catherine, but I checked this website to be sure and found two others. Thomas and Ambrose.
Each saint has a back story which the site tells you some of, whenever I was looking for a saint I liked to be sure I know some about him or her and could connect in someway with the Saint I was going to be asking for help.

I'll post the iugnay to these three's profiles here for you to check out (:

St. Thomas(Patron saint of Catholic schools, Colleges, Schools, and Students):
link

St. Catherine (Patron saint of Philosophers and Students):
link

St. Ambrose (Patron saint of Bee Keepers(though that parts unimportant lol) and Learning.):
link

While praying can be a huge comfort and definitely boost your confidence, be careful not to rely completely on prayer, especially when it comes to academics. Make sure you get the tutoring and studying help you need as well (:
